A Man for All Seasons is a 1966 British film directed and produced by Fred Zinnemann, based on a play by Robert Bolt. It depicts the lawyer and then-Lord Chancellor of England, St. Thomas More, as he navigates the turbulent waters of faith, conscience, loyalty, and ambition in England under Henry VIII. The film poses ambitious and important questions en route to showing us how Thomas was truly a man for any season.
